Output 654a59318730e1d2978c05792d2f4c0ee87958b473730be67ad8956aae95640f:1

value
131512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ea90cee44e41b95590e1def2e366c9bcdba31f97 OP_EQUAL
address
3P5HWt1E2uFvDmxveYkaSZ9ZjZvNum81j1
transaction
654a59318730e1d2978c05792d2f4c0ee87958b473730be67ad8956aae95640f
confirmations
311904
spent
true